Ticket: BounceSift worker dropping connections

Since last night's deploy, the BounceSift email bounce processor has been failing to hold its database connection for longer than ninety seconds. Retries succeed briefly, then drop again, so bounce classification is lagging by roughly two hours. Please verify pool settings against the staging baseline. For reference, the connection string currently in use is:

replica DSN, kajep-yahag: mssql://praok_svc:iF@db-8d68.plorvaio.local:5432/eliion

Finance Review Summary — Board, Ostrell Fabrication

Project Lanward remains nine weeks behind schedule. Spend to date: 112% of phase budget, driven by rework and contractor overruns. Forecast completion pushed to Q2. Scope trimmed to core deliverables; non-essential modules deferred. Accountability review assigned to the operations lead. No further funding requested this quarter. The contingency position is outlined confidentially below.

board note of baguf-fafog: Kasixox Foods plans to lower the Drueth list price by 48 percent in March.

**Alert: ReportForge exports showing wrong timestamps**

This fires when exported CSVs contain timestamps more than an hour off from the tenant's configured timezone. Usually it means the tz-cache in the export worker went stale after a deploy. Quick fix: bounce the worker pool and re-run the failed exports. Triage steps are on the internal page.

dashboard of yafog-fajof = https://jira.tolvaqsys.internal/pages/pages/projects/49fe21c4

Subject: Q3 Budget Request — Field Enablement

Executive team,

The sales leads at Vantrell Systems are requesting an additional 140k for the Q3 field enablement programme. The funds cover demo kits for the Kestrelline launch, travel for the Marbrook regional tour, and two contract trainers. Current pipeline coverage suggests the spend pays back within two quarters. Detailed line items are attached for review before Thursday's session. Approval is needed by month-end to secure vendor rates.

confidential, tagag-kahof: Rusathox Partners plans to lower the Gorox list price by 63 percent in December.